Transaction 7bc645caf305a7e894e3ba14802177f612f55a1043cb5a9c562dcb7a39d93f20
1 Input
1 Output
-
7bc645caf305a7e894e3ba14802177f612f55a1043cb5a9c562dcb7a39d93f20:0
- value
- 1527127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95c5d417f2f42f9177d6d253911f870a15847e26 OP_EQUAL
- address
- 3FLwbVRtbBbUyErjBQdjHWarz6HNxyPBdA